- The distance between Espinosa, Brazil and Base Antartica B. O’Hig, Antarctica is approximately 5,483 km or 3,407 mi.
- To reach Espinosa in this distance one would set out from Base Antartica B. O’Hig bearing 17.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Espinosa bearing 8.2° or N .
- Espinosa has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Base Antartica B. O’Hig has a tundra climate (ET).
- The average temperature is 28 °C (50.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.3 °C (9.5°F) less in Espinosa.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 20.7 mm (0.8 in) less which is equivalent to 20.7 l/m² (0.51 US gal/ft²) or 207,000 l/ha (22,130 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 44.8° higher in Espinosa than in Base Antartica B. O’Hig.
- Relative humidity levels are 22%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 21.9°C (39.5°F) higher.
